How Bluehost Daily Backups Work (CodeGuard Basic Explained)
Bluehost integrates CodeGuard Basic into most of its mid- and upper-tier plans to provide automatic, cloud-based backups. The goal? Give you peace of mind with daily, behind-the-scenes protection—so you can restore your website anytime with one click.
Here’s how it actually works:
🔄 What CodeGuard Basic Does
Once activated (automatically on eligible plans), CodeGuard Basic will:
- ✅ Back up your website once every 24 hours
- ✅ Include files, folders, themes, plugins, and databases
- ✅ Retain the last 30 days of backup versions
- ✅ Track file changes and notify you via email if suspicious edits are made
- ✅ Let you restore your site to any previous clean version
No configuration. No manual effort. It just runs.
💾 What Gets Backed Up?
- ✅ Your entire WordPress installation (core, themes, uploads)
- ✅ All images, videos, and media in your media library
- ✅ Your MySQL database (posts, pages, comments, user data)
- ✅ Plugin settings and customizations
Essentially, your entire site can be rebuilt with a single restore—perfect if something breaks or is accidentally deleted.
⚙️ Where to Access It in Bluehost:
- Log in to your Bluehost dashboard
- Go to Websites > Manage Site
- Click the “Backups” tab
- View available restore points and click “Restore” on the one you want
You can choose to restore:
- Only files
- Only the database
- Or the entire site at once

CodeGuard Premium vs Basic: Is the Upgrade Worth It?
While CodeGuard Basic (included for free on most mid-tier Bluehost plans) offers reliable daily backups and restore functionality, CodeGuard Premium unlocks more powerful features that advanced users and businesses may find essential.
Let’s break down the differences:
🆚 CodeGuard Basic (Free)
- ✅ Daily backups (every 24 hours)
- ✅ 30-day backup retention
- ✅ 1-click restore (files, database, or full site)
- ✅ Change detection alerts via email
- ❌ No downloadable backup files
- ❌ No on-demand backups
- ❌ Only covers one site
Great for:
- Bloggers
- Static business sites
- Beginners who just need automatic protection
🚀 CodeGuard Premium (Paid Add-On)
- ✅ All features of Basic, plus:
- ✅ Unlimited backup retention (store months of versions)
- ✅ Downloadable backups (store locally for offline safety)
- ✅ On-demand backups before major updates
- ✅ Multiple website coverage from one dashboard
- ✅ Individual file restoration (roll back one plugin, not your whole site)
Perfect for:
- WooCommerce or client sites
- Agencies handling multiple websites
- Developers who need control over changes
- Sites undergoing frequent updates or redesigns
💡 CodeGuard Premium starts around $2.99/month but varies based on storage and site count.
📌 Final Take
If you’re running a content-heavy site or online business, the upgrade is worth it for deeper control and redundancy. But for most casual bloggers or small site owners, CodeGuard Basic is more than enough.

FAQs: Bluehost Daily Website Backups
Does Bluehost back up websites daily?
Yes. Bluehost includes CodeGuard Basic with daily backups on Choice Plus, Online Store, and Pro plans.
Can I restore my site if it crashes?
Yes. You can restore your entire site, database, or files with one click from your Bluehost dashboard.
Is CodeGuard Premium worth the extra cost?
It is if you manage multiple sites, need on-demand backups, or want to download your backup files for extra safety.
Do backups include images, plugins, and settings?
Yes. Bluehost backups include all WordPress core files, themes, plugins, uploads, and the full database.
